Chloragogen cells/Chlorocyte cells/eleocytes/yellow cells: Chloragogen cells are small, star-shaped with small nucleus. These are also termed as Phagocytes (engulfing excretory wastes) as they consist engulfing foreign materials like bacteria in cytoplasm.
